7 months non stop headache after a bad fall

My husband 44 years old and healthy but over weight has had a bad headache every day non stop for 7 months now. It all started when he fell into a 10 foot empty swimming pool. He didnt hit or hurt his head or neck area but took the impact on his hip area which only briused him Since that day he has had a non stop headache on the right side near temple area. He has had a set of xrays, 2 mri's and has seen a neurosurgeon (due to a shunt he had placed wen he was 20 but it hasnt worked in over 15 years and drs say everything looks great so its not from the shunt) hes seen a neurologist that has sceduled him for an eeg tomorrow. So far all they keep doing is giving him different pills to try since all tests have come back normal. He is currently taking 3 gabapentin 100mg at bedtime and ibuprofen 800mg 2-3 times a day. A couple of months ago is when he started to take the gabapentin and it did seem to start working little by little they faded till he actually went 5 days with no headache untill the neurologist told him to take indomethacin 25 mg 3 times a day them boom the headaches came back worse. He did stop the ibuprofens when taking this. After a few days he stopped taking them because we felt it brought back the headaches. Noone has checked his neck at all could it be a neck issue i was told maybe its his c1. Any ideas would be great, We've tried verything it seems and have seen 4 drs and noone has any ideas and are just testing out different pills. Please help.
